Walt Disney World Adjusts Reopening Dates for Select Hotels Including Polynesian Village & Art of Animation

As Walt Disney World continues to reopen, schedules are adjusting.

Two reopening dates for hotel areas are being pushed back. Polynesian village, which was originally supposed to reopen August 12th, will now prepare for an October 4th reopening.

The Art of Animation Resort was also supposed to reopen August 12th, but that date has been pushed back to November 1st.

Disney has also removed reopening dates for Beach Club and Boardwalk Inn.

Here’s the current schedule:

  • July 29: Disney’s Caribbean Beach Resort
  • August 24: Disney’s Yacht Club Resort
  • September 21: Disney’s Grand Floridian Resort & Spa
  • October 4: Disney’s Polynesian Village Resort
  • October 14: Disney’s Coronado Springs Resort
  • November 1: Disney’s Art of Animation Resort

As previously mentioned, Beach Club and Boardwalk Inn no longer have reopening dates.
